NEW DATES INCLUDE FIRST-EVER HOLLYWOOD BOWL CONCERT, FIRST SHOWS IN LAKE TAHOE, TWO NIGHTS AT THE GORGE IN GEORGE, WA, THREE NIGHTS AT CHICAGO'S UIC PAVILION
Phish announced additional dates to their 2011 Summer Tour, including the band's first-ever concert at the Hollywood Bowl (and their first Los Angeles appearance since 2003), and their first shows in Lake Tahoe. The band will also play in San Francisco at the Outside Land's Music Festival in Golden Gate Park, two consecutive nights at The Gorge in George, WA and a three- night stand at Chicago's UIC Pavilion.
Phish kicks off their 2011 Summer Tour on Memorial Day weekend, with three consecutive nights (May 27, 28 & 29) at Bethel Woods Center for the Arts in Bethel, NY. Stops along the way include Cleveland, Cincinnati, Mansfield, Darien Lake and more, as well as 2-night runs in Holmdel, Columbia and Alpharetta. The band also plays host to Super Ball IX,their own 3-Day Festival over Fourth of July Weekend in Watkins Glen, NY. The band will not be touring this fall.
